How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Paseo?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Paseo Studio Apartments | $2,656 | $1,200 | $4,698 |
Paseo 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,547 | $1,200 | $8,962 |
Paseo 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,348 | $2,000 | $10,000+ |
Paseo 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,097 | $3,346 | $7,952 |
